1. What is a Engineering Manager at British Airways?
The Engineering & Maintenance Strategy Manager at British Airways is a pivotal role that bridges the gap between high-level operational strategy and the technical execution required to maintain a world-class fleet. You are not just managing engineering processes; you are ensuring that the complex machinery of a global airline operates safely, efficiently, and in alignment with long-term business goals.
In this role, you will influence the lifecycle of aircraft maintenance, supplier relationships, and the technical standards that define British Airways. Your work directly impacts the reliability of flight operations and the company's bottom line. Whether you are optimizing maintenance schedules or navigating intricate procurement decisions, your leadership is essential to maintaining the operational excellence that passengers expect from a global carrier.
This role requires a unique blend of technical engineering expertise and strategic business acumen. You will work within the high-stakes environment of Heathrow and other hubs, collaborating with diverse teams to solve complex logistical challenges. It is an ideal position for leaders who thrive in regulated environments where safety, precision, and efficiency are the primary currencies.
